Barbarians Too Good For Whakatane B
The old timers the Barbarians, proved just a little too heady in the backs and the forwards, for the Whakatane B representatives in the curtain raiser on the Domain on Saturday. Though lacking a little wind they could' still beat the younger team by 16 to 6. The Barbarians outstripped the B’s in both departments and showed up the fact that low tackling is the only way to bring a man down. Back rushes were altogether too heady and tricky for the younger team. A.lot of ground was losif by the B’s through tackling round the neck, and the * old players simply backed through the tackle. Scorers • were: Barbarians (16 points): B. McGougan, J. Keepa, Dodds and Hohapata a try each; Hohapata and Oswald a conversion each. ; Whakatane B’s (6 points): D. Morpeth and Kain a try each.
